Sunlink Engineering fabricates RHS Steel Stanchions using rectangular hollow section steel for applications requiring clean geometry, high structural strength, and stable load-bearing performance. Serving clients across Singapore and Johor, Malaysia, our RHS stanchions are widely used in industrial facilities, infrastructure projects, marine environments, and safety systems.
RHS steel stanchions provide excellent rigidity and resistance to bending and torsion, making them suitable for railings, barriers, platforms, equipment supports, and structural demarcation. Each stanchion is fabricated with precision cutting, controlled welding, and accurate alignment to ensure consistent quality and reliable installation.

RHS steel stanchions can be fabricated with:
Base plates for bolting to concrete or steel structures
Flanged, welded, or embedded mounting options
Pre-drilled holes or welded brackets for rail connections
Custom RHS sizes, wall thicknesses, and heights
Painted, powder-coated, galvanised, or raw steel finishes
